Welcome to the forum! You have several options here. Getting a used OEM bag and wheel will certainly be the cheapest option. There are also several aftermarket options that still retain the use of the stock airbag. That would cost more (and you would still need to find an airbag). However, it would be a nice upgrade without sacrificing safety. The other option would be to switch to a C6 steering wheel. If you do a search, there a few threads on how to do this. If you decide on this option, you would use a C6 airbag instead on the C5. The C6 wheel is smaller (which a lot of people prefer). The C6 wheel also has some control buttons that can be made functional for an additional cost. Good luck!
